Known globally as Zomato, the company has rebranded itself as Eternal Ltd. This change, which was confirmed in a recent regulatory filing to the stock exchanges, marks the culmination of a transformation process that began over two years ago within the organization. Even though the corporate identity is now set to be known as Eternal Ltd, the familiar Zomato brand and its user-friendly app will continue to serve loyal customers, ensuring that the connection with the brand remains as strong as ever. However, the new name awaits further approval from shareholders, the Ministry of Corporate Affairs, and other regulatory authorities before it is fully implemented.

This bold decision to change the corporate name is much more than a cosmetic update—it signals a comprehensive evolution in the company’s strategic vision. Traditionally recognized for revolutionizing food delivery in India, Zomato has steadily expanded its scope, diversifying into several new areas. Over time, the business has grown to encompass operations that extend well beyond food delivery. Today, alongside its core platform, the company also manages Blinkit, a rapid commerce service that delivers everyday essentials at an accelerated pace; District, a venture that brings live events and B2B logistics into the mix; and Hyperpure, which supplies premium kitchen products to restaurants and other culinary businesses. By adopting the new name Eternal Ltd, the company aims to encapsulate this broader, more diversified approach—a reflection of its ambition to be seen not just as a food delivery service, but as a multi-faceted enterprise with a commitment to innovation and longevity.

The change in name was formally announced by Deepinder Goyal, the founder and CEO of the company, through a well-crafted message on social media. In his announcement, Goyal emphasized that the board had given its approval for the change, and he earnestly appealed to shareholders to back the decision. In his own words, he invited stakeholders to support this significant step, noting that the change is a natural progression in the company’s evolution. Although the external identity of Zomato will remain intact for everyday users, this rebranding reflects an internal shift towards a more integrated and expansive business model. As part of the transformation, the company’s website is slated to transition from the familiar “zomato.com” to “eternal.com,” and the stock ticker on financial exchanges will also be updated accordingly.
